Post by: bewley on Jul 6, 2017 A horizontal disk rotates about a vertical axis through its center. Point P is midway between the center and the rim of the disk, and point Q is on the rim. If the disk turns with constant angular velocity, which of the following statements about it are true? (There may be more than one correct choice.)
A) P and Q have the same linear acceleration. B) Q is moving twice as fast as P. C) The linear acceleration of Q is twice as great as the linear acceleration of P. D) The linear acceleration of P is twice as great as the linear acceleration of Q. E) The angular velocity of Q is twice as great as the angular velocity of P.
